Lot Description
[LEWIS & CLARK]
JEFFERSON, Thomas. "Messages of the President of the United States." - LEWIS, Meriwether. "Letter from Capt. Clark", St. Louis, 23 September 1806. - PIKE, Zebulon. "Account of a Voyage up the Mississippi River." In: The Political Cabinet. [Boston, 1806-1807]. 8vo (245 x 152 mm). Vol.III, pp.9-96; Vol.IV, pp.1-16, 25-32, 41-80. (Vol.III lacking pp.1-8, Vol.IV lacking pp.17-24 and pp.33-40, some pale spotting.) Disbound, uncut, stab holes. Issued as appendicies to Vols. III and IV of The Monthly Anthology, with the running title "American State Papers." The publisher suggests in an introductory paragraph that the works might be removed and bound as a separate work. Contains reports about Sibley, Dunbar, and Hunter's explorations. Sabin 40826; Wagner-Camp 5b.
